I've found that walking backwards is a good way to whiff punish with the parry , most ppl jump in like crazy and always input there follow up combos in mid air , I've noticed I'm getting good results with walking back just enough to clear their jip/jik and then parry.
At most distances you have to be already walking back befor they jump to make them whiff the ji

This dude is steadily laying out solid fundamentals for Sub Zero players. There's a character walk/ run speed thread on these boards somewhere. If I remember correctly, SZ's walk back speed is actually pretty low. Compare it to Jacqui's (fastest walk forward/ back speed) and use accordingly.

Good info to know though. Between walk speeds and good normals, this can dictate how a match up is likely to go before it starts.

What made me make a thread is the fact that gm and cryo don't benifit from this kind of footsies , cryo has mix ups and with gm the whole point is to push them not backtrack , so I've never really thought to just back myself into the corner , just looking for honest opinions on if it's feasible to stay walking back the whole match like FA jacquis do

All variations benefit from space control. You could argue Cryo benefits most due to the damage he could deal after. I specifically land a "walk back (opp. whiffs jip) b12 trip guard" set up, pretty often. Walk back > slide and walk back > d4 work fairly well for me as well.
